Transaction 66b6229557fb77be79032c867a899415aa715897ce65f84d196f23b801b9797c

1 Input
2 Outputs
  • 66b6229557fb77be79032c867a899415aa715897ce65f84d196f23b801b9797c:0
  • value  594849
    address  1HKwotrdjzj85cB5cuFPjtvkVdiRntznAL
  • 66b6229557fb77be79032c867a899415aa715897ce65f84d196f23b801b9797c:1
  • value  93531359
    address  1rDwsdrxVEuBYUaVLjUAmZZtKfHAwPHvW